Services Offered
- Comprehensive Wellness and Preventative Care: These services are foundational for long-term pet health, including thorough nose-to-tail annual physical examinations, tailored vaccination protocols based on your pet’s age, breed, lifestyle, and environment, and comprehensive parasite prevention programs (covering fleas, ticks, and heartworm). They also offer individualized nutritional counseling to maintain optimal weight and well-being.
- Advanced Diagnostic Services: To ensure accurate and timely diagnoses, Valley Veterinary Services utilizes state-of-the-art diagnostic tools. This includes comprehensive in-house laboratory testing for rapid results (blood chemistry, complete blood counts, urinalysis, fecal exams), as well as modern digital radiography (X-rays) and ultrasound imaging for detailed views of internal organs and structures.
- Comprehensive Dental Services: Recognizing the importance of oral health, the clinic provides full dental care, from routine prophylactic cleanings, polishing, and digital dental X-rays to more advanced procedures such as dental extractions and the treatment of periodontal disease, all performed under safe anesthesia.
- Surgical Procedures: The hospital offers a wide array of surgical services, including routine procedures like spaying and neutering, various soft tissue surgeries, and orthopedic procedures. Patient safety is a top priority, with advanced anesthetic and monitoring technology ensuring comfort and minimal pain.
- Urgent Care: Valley Veterinary Services is equipped to handle non-life-threatening urgent care cases during their regular hospital hours, prioritizing prompt attention for sudden illnesses or injuries. They also provide guidance on alternative emergency options for after-hours or critical needs.
- End-of-Life Care: Providing compassionate support and guidance during the difficult time of a pet's passing. This includes humane euthanasia performed with dignity and care, often with sedation administered beforehand to ensure the pet is at ease. They are happy to accommodate special requests and assist with arrangements for cremation.
- Exotic Pet Care: A specialized service for a variety of unique pets, including reptiles, birds, small mammals like guinea pigs, rabbits, ferrets, chinchillas, rats, hamsters, and gerbils, offering care tailored to their distinct physiological needs.
- Senior Pet Care: Focused attention on the specific needs of aging pets, including more frequent wellness exams and adjustments to diet, exercise, and healthcare plans to manage age-related conditions.
- Nutrition Counseling: Individualized nutritional recommendations based on thorough body-condition evaluations, providing important information on proper serving size, nutrient needs, and feeding strategies.
- Spay/Neuter Services: Essential surgical procedures to prevent unwanted litters and reduce the risk of certain health issues.
- Vetsource Online Pharmacy: Partnership with Vetsource to allow clients to order food, medications, and other pet products online conveniently.
